WebUpdating your name, date of birth or gender. You can call us on the Medicare program line to make some updates to your name or date of birth. You’ll need to prove your identity over the phone. Updates we can make for you over the phone include: changing your legal name, for example changing from a maiden to married name.

WebYou can upload your Newborn Child Declaration form using your Medicare online account. We’ll enrol your baby and add them to your Medicare card. We’ll also add them to the Australian Immunisation Register . We’ll send you a new Medicare card with your baby on it. You should get it in 3 to 4 weeks.
